FRANKLIN TWP. Under the Stars continues at the Red Barn Theatre this weekend with the second in the series, Red Barn Bandstand.
Take a musical journey back to saddle shoes and circle skirts with songs from the 1950s and 60s. Close your eyes and remember those days as Janaya Daniel sings Ella Fitzgerald s Dream a Little Dream and Ryan Lubin sings John Denver s unforgettable Leaving on a Jet Plane.
When Sue Ann Atkin and Lauranne Ferrara sing Bye Bye Love, which the Everly Brothers made famous, you can remember a long-lost love but not feel sad but be happy when Andrea and Shelly Cary sing Happy Days are Here Again. It s an evening of nostalgia and a little wistfulness.
